yo your guitar sounds great!! I've ben trying to make a guitar with no nobs, only an on and off kill switch. After I took out all the pots and swiches it became way to hot a signal. I added a resister to try and simulate the pots and now it squeels every time I touch the bridge,the dudes at my local shop don't know what to do. Any help?

Yo . . . Billy,
Would you drive your car with the throttle unhooked? When I did the conversion from ordinary single pick ups to the humbuckers I bought on eBay I too did not know how to hook them up. I found the answers on the web. Basically you need on common right through but the other line needs a pot for volume and a pot for tone. The tone pot usually has a capacitor across it. There is no one way to hook these up but throw the resistor out, you are only increasing the resistance which drives the voltage up. Good luck.
